Can A Registered Nurse Afford Rent in Lebanon, MO?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 12.1% of gross income.

Lebanon rent: April 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Missouri state estimate).

Lebanon median rent
$879/mo
Registered Nurse salary (Missouri)
$86,922/yr
Rent as % of income
12.1%
Gross monthly income works out to about $7,244, and the 30% rule supports up to $2,173/mo in rent. Lebanon's median rent of $879 leaves roughly $1,294/mo of headroom under that threshold. A registered nurse works roughly 21 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Missouri state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Lebanon, MO.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
